Plugin authors hitting rotation failures in Keyspin CI: the utility now refuses to rotate secrets older than the manifest epoch. Regenerate your plugin manifest before retrying, and confirm the sandbox stage passes twice in a row. Stale caches are the usual cause. When filing a report, include the trace token printed beneath this note.

session token of bawep-yadup = htk21_528abd376e3c5a4ec24a1

# NOTE for security review: intermittent DNS failures resolving the Quorline
# metrics host caused retry storms last sprint. Workaround: pinned resolver
# in the container base image; see ops ticket. No credentials were logged
# during the incident. This file is the single source of runtime secrets.
# The Quorline ingest token belongs on the very next line.

secret setting of yagef-baweg: RELAY_SECRET29=cb53deb59a49ed54d9f43599b54ca

## Build Provenance: UI Snapshot Testing

Welcome to the Larkspur team. Our UI component snapshots are regenerated on every build of the Pinefold design system, and each snapshot set is tied to the exact build that produced it. Never commit snapshots generated locally; only CI-produced sets are accepted, since local font rendering differs. Each accepted set is identified by the token below.

build token for kagaf-hahof: htk14_9d3d4d26d7d8de

## Deployment

The KioskKeep watchdog ships as a sidecar. It restarts the kiosk UI on hang, reboots the unit after three consecutive failures, and phones home heartbeats. Reviewers: check that the restart backoff is exponential and the reboot ceiling is enforced — a bad build once reboot-looped forty units at the Dunmore pilot. Builds are signed; unsigned binaries are refused. Deployment expects the following configuration values.

config for kafof-bawef:
holath:
  log_level: debug
  metrics_host: metrics.holath.qorvelsys.internal
  pin: 2191
  pool_size: 32